### Dedup pipeline capacity — Mergecrest

Plugin authors: the matcher runs in fixed-size batches and your similarity hooks execute inside that budget. Blocking calls in a hook stall the whole batch, so keep per-record work under the stated ceiling or offload to the async lane. Candidate pairs are capped per record; exceeding the cap silently truncates, which skews recall. Plan shard counts around peak ingest, not average. Batch sizes and ceilings are the constants below.

tuning table, kajog-bawip:
TIERS = {
    "kelius": 256,
    "lammir": 543,
}

## Gridfill Environments

Quick map for on-call: the CSV import wizard (Gridfill) runs in three environments — dev, staging, and prod. Dev resets nightly, so don't chase stale imports there. Staging shares the parser pool with prod, which is why a bad upload in staging can page you. If an import wedges, restart the worker, not the web tier. Prod currently runs with the following configuration.

deployment values, faduf-tawep:
SORDOR_LOG_LEVEL=error
SORDOR_METRICS_HOST=metrics.sordor.nelvrolabs.internal
SORDOR_POOL_SIZE=4

## Runbook: GridSmith generation stalls

If the GridSmith crossword generator stops emitting puzzles, first confirm the solver pool is alive before restarting anything; a restart with a corrupted wordlist cache will simply stall again. Drain the queue, clear the cache directory, then restart the worker with the canonical settings. Verify each value carefully against drift before proceeding. The worker must be started with exactly these configuration values:

settings of tagef-bawif:
DRUIX_HOST=druix.zemvarlabs.internal
DRUIX_PORT=8000

Ticket #PR-4417 — Missed Pick-up, "Paper Lanterns" Props

Hey — the Dray & Fletcher van never showed yesterday, so the lantern rigs and the fold-up stage moon are still sitting in the loading bay. Rebooked for tomorrow, 09:30. Can you be on hand to sign? When the new driver turns up, give them the instruction noted just below.

handover note for yagef-bagep: the drudor pelius courier leaves the kasdor zorvan norir ledger at gate 8016 under passcode 755406